To Increase Carrying Capacity of Tapi River Using HEC-RAS Software

Sania Modak, Prashant Nagarnaik


Abstract: In the present study, One-Dimensional steady flow analysis using flood events and unsteady flow analysis using daily discharge flow and daily tidal level. Tapi River from weir cum causeway to Magadalla Bridge and also evaluation for flood situation in 1883, 1884, 1942, 2006, and 2013 is carried out using steady flow and unsteady flow analysis. HEC-RAS software is used for analysis.


Keywords: HEC-RAS, One-Dimensional steady flow analysis, flood control, Tapi River, discharge
